Comparison the effect of Tiva anesthesia with isoflurane on liver enzymes activity in patients undergoing laparoscopic cholecystectomy
Design
The study is a randomized double-blind clinical trial
Settings and conduct
Imam Ali Hospital of Bojnourd, North Khorasan University of Medical Sciences
Participants/Inclusion and excl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: signing informed consent to participate in the study; has no history of anesthesia in the past 6 months; the patient's age is between 18 and 70 years old; be in accordance with ASA grade one or two grade anesthesia; no history of specific drug use; does not have a specific underlying disease such as liver disease.
Exclusion criteria: the patient needs more pharmacotherapy during acne surgery; patients may require cardiopulmonary resuscitation during surgery; inability to exit the endotracheal tube at the end of surgery; intraoperative bleeding; laparoscopic transformation to open excessive liver damage during surgery and surgeon manipulation.
Intervention groups
Atracurium (0.5 mg / kg) and propofol (2 mg / kg) are used to induce anesthesia. After 3 minutes of hyperventilating and intubation, anesthesia was administered in the first group of isoflurane 1.2 mg and in the second group propofol 100 µg / kg with remifenil. (0.1 mcg for body weight per minute) will be used. Surgery will then be performed on all patients by a laparoscopic specialist with a qualified general surgery specialist who is blind to the drugs. After surgery and discontinuation of anesthesia, a reversal of injection (neostecmin plus atropine) will be performed for all patients with the aim of restoring the patient's muscle strength and spontaneous ventilation.
Main outcome variables
Hepatic Enzyme ALT; Hepatic Enzyme AST; Hepatic Enzyme ALP

Intervention groups
1
Description
After the patient enters the operating room, the supine position extends over the operating room bed and is monitored initially. An oximeter probe and pressure gauge cuff are attached to the patient's hand and a ringer serum is provided to the patient. Midazolam (2 mg) and fentanyl (100 mcg) were administered in all patients. Atracurium (0.5 mg / kg) and propofol (2 mg / kg) are used to induce anesthesia. After 3 minutes of hyperventilating the patient and performing the intubation, isoflurane inhaler anesthetic of 1.2 mc is used to maintain anesthesia in the first group.
Category
Treatment - Drugs
2
Description
After the patient enters the operating room, the supine position extends over the operating room bed and is monitored initially. An oximeter probe and pressure gauge cuff are attached to the patient's hand and a ringer serum is provided to the patient. Midazolam (2 mg) and fentanyl (100 mcg) were administered in all patients. Atracurium (0.5 mg / kg) and propofol (2 mg / kg) are used to induce anesthesia. After 3 minutes hyperventilating the patient and performing the intubation, propofol intravenous anesthetic is administered in the anesthetic phase of 100 micrograms per kg body weight plus remifanil (0.1 micrograms per minute body weight).
